Pagwi
Village
Pagwi is a village and township on the Sepik River in Gawi Rural LLG of East Sepik Province, Papua New Guinea, north-east of Ambunti. Linked by road to Wewak, about 4 or 5 hours away on the coast, the Chambri Lakes are nearby to the south. Pagwi is situated 9 km northwest of Yentchanmangua.
